Ruth Bader Ginsburg: Her Legacy And Why We Must Continue The Fight For Women

Ruth Bader Ginsburg was a trailblazer who lived a life defined by strength, fortitude and determination. The second woman to serve on the U.S. Supreme Court, Ruth played a significant part in working toward gender equality.  She was a powerful liberal voice on the United States Supreme Court, appointed by Bill Clinton in 1993.
